The Icom dock requires a clean contact cycle to complete the BMS handshake before it begins charging — a smudged contact is the most common cause of a first-insertion fault.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n  \u003chr class=\"bpw-desc-divider\"\u003e\n\n  \u003ch3 class=\"bpw-desc-h3\"\u003eIC-F3001 charger dock fault LED after BP-265 swap\u003c\/h3\u003e\n  \u003cp class=\"bpw-desc-p\"\u003eThe Icom rapid-charge dock reads BMS data through the gold contact pins before it opens the charge circuit. A new BP-265 ships at storage voltage — typically around 3.7–3.8V per cell — which sits below the dock's ready-to-charge acceptance threshold on some firmware revisions. The dock interprets this as a fault rather than a low cell. Seat the battery, wait 10 seconds, remove it, and reseat once. If the fault LED persists, check that all three gold contacts are making flush contact — a bent pin on the dock is a separate issue from the pack itself.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n  \u003ch3 class=\"bpw-desc-h3\"\u003eBar indicator showing one fewer bar than expected on a new BP-265\u003c\/h3\u003e\n  \u003cp class=\"bpw-desc-p\"\u003eThe IC-3101 and IC-F3001 series use a voltage-threshold bar indicator — no fuel gauge chip, just fixed voltage breakpoints. A new pack at storage voltage reads lower than a fully charged one, so the radio displays one or two bars even though the cells are not depleted. Run the pack through one full charge cycle in the dock until the green LED confirms completion. After that first full charge, the bar count will reflect actual cell state.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"BatteryWeb","offers":[{"title":"Warranty 1 Year","offer_id":43426333491290,"sku":"BWCS-ICM410TW-1","price":40.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true},{"title":"Warranty 2 Year","offer_id":43426333524058,"sku":"BWCS-ICM410TW-2","price":47.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true},{"title":"Warranty 3 Year","offer_id":43426333556826,"sku":"BWCS-ICM410TW-3","price":52.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0674\/4775\/0746\/files\/BW-CS-ICM410TW-1.webp?v=1779930721","url":"https:\/\/batteryweb.com\/products\/icom-ic-3101-replacement-battery-74v-2600mah-li-ion","provider":"BatteryWeb","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
